1. Check Whether the Smart Lock Manufacturer Has Real OEM/ODM Experience
OEM means the factory makes products under your brand. ODM means the factory can also help design and develop the product. For smart locks, ODM ability is very important. A smart lock needs mechanical design, PCBA hardware, embedded software, app connection, testing, packaging, and user instructions. If one part is weak, the full product can fail in the market.
A strong OEM/ODM smart lock manufacturer should support the full path from idea to mass production. This includes concept discussion, industrial design, structural design, mold development, sample making, pilot production, quality control, global logistics support, and after-sales technical help. When you speak with a factory, ask for real project steps. Do not only ask for product photos. Ask how they handle a new lock from the first drawing to the final carton. A professional team should explain each stage clearly. They should also show how they reduce risk before mass production. This is especially important for smart deadbolt locks, smart handle locks, hotel locks, apartment locks, and office access locks.
| Evaluation Area | What to Ask | Why It Matters |
|---|---|---|
| Product Development | Can you support ID design, structure, PCBA, firmware, app, and packaging? | It lowers the need to manage many separate suppliers. |
| Private Mold | Can you develop exclusive tooling for our brand? | It helps protect product difference and market position. |
| Integration | Can you support Bluetooth, WiFi, Tuya, TTLock, API, or SDK access? | It helps the lock connect with smart home or property systems. |
| Production Path | Do you offer samples, pilot runs, and mass production? | It helps find issues before large orders begin. |
| After-Sales Support | Can your engineers help after shipment? | It reduces pressure on your brand team when users need help. |
2. Review R&D Strength, Patents, and Engineering Background
Smart locks combine several technologies. They use mechanical parts, motors, sensors, wireless modules, circuit boards, batteries, and software. This means the engineering team matters as much as the production line. A weak R&D team may copy a product shape but fail to solve real user problems. These problems may include slow fingerprint reading, short battery life, poor weather resistance, app connection failure, or unstable unlocking.

Buyers should also ask how the factory designs for different use cases. A lock for a family entry door is different from a lock for an apartment project or a hotel project. A residential lock may need simple setup and strong battery performance. A property lock may need platform access and remote management. A hotel lock may need card access and fast guest turnover support. Good engineering teams ask these questions early. They do not push one standard model for every customer.
Smart home compatibility is another key topic. The Connectivity Standards Alliance Matter standard shows how important device interoperability has become in the smart home market. Even if your current product does not use Matter, your manufacturer should understand smart home ecosystems and future integration needs.
3. Verify Certifications and Market Compliance Before You Place a Large Order
Certification is not a decoration. It is a market access tool. If your product uses wireless functions, power circuits, or electronic control, it may need testing before it can be sold in target markets. For example, the FCC equipment authorization program is important for radio frequency devices sold in the United States. For Europe, the European Commission CE marking guidance explains that CE marking shows a product meets applicable EU requirements.
A reliable smart lock factory should understand these needs early. It should tell you which certificates are available, which tests may be needed, and which product changes may affect approval. For buyers, the main lesson is simple. Do not wait until the first container is ready to discuss compliance. Build the certificate plan into the project timeline. Ask for test reports, certificate scope, model coverage, and brand label rules. Also ask whether firmware, wireless modules, or structural changes will require retesting. This helps prevent customs delays, platform listing problems, and distributor complaints.
| Requirement | Relevant Market or Use | Buyer Action |
|---|---|---|
| FCC / FCCID | United States wireless electronic products | Confirm model number, wireless module, and label requirements. |
| CE | European market product safety and conformity | Check technical file, declaration, and applicable directives. |
| ISO9001 | Factory quality management | Ask how the quality system is used on the production floor. |
| ISO14001 | Environmental management | Review how the factory controls environmental impact and process risk. |
| QC080000 / IECQ | Hazardous substance process control | Ask how materials and suppliers are controlled. |
The ISO 9001 quality management standard is widely used to manage quality systems. The ISO 14001 environmental management standard helps organizations manage environmental responsibilities. These standards are useful signals, but they should not replace factory audits. A certificate is strongest when it is supported by real process control.

5. Audit Quality Control, Testing Steps, and Traceability
Quality control is the heart of smart lock manufacturing. A lock may look good in photos, but it must work every day in real homes. It must survive repeated unlocking, battery changes, temperature changes, hand contact, door movement, and sometimes outdoor conditions. Small defects can become expensive after the product reaches customers.

Buyers should ask what is tested at each stage. Useful checks may include incoming material inspection, PCBA test, motor function test, fingerprint or keypad function test, wireless connection test, battery performance check, emergency power test, aging test, surface inspection, packing inspection, and final random inspection. For smart locks, traceability is also critical. If a problem appears in the market, you need to know which batch, which components, and which process may be involved.
Cybersecurity should also be discussed. A smart lock may connect to an app, cloud service, or property system. The NISTIR 8425 consumer IoT cybersecurity profile gives useful guidance for consumer IoT product security. You do not need to turn every purchasing meeting into a security lecture. But you should ask simple questions. How are app permissions managed? How is firmware updated? How are default passwords avoided? How is user data protected?
6. Compare Product Range, Custom Features, and Application Fit
A strong smart lock supplier should not only offer one lock body. Different markets need different lock types. For example, North American homes may prefer smart deadbolts. Some modern homes may prefer smart handle locks. Apartments may need app control and user management. Hotels may need card access and simple room operations. Offices may need stronger access control and management systems.

Unlocking methods are also important. Some products support password, key, fingerprint, card, app, or a mix of these options. A buyer should not choose more functions only because they look attractive. Choose functions based on the user. A rental property may need app access. A family entry door may need fingerprint and keypad access. A low-cost product line may need password and key access. A premium product may need app, fingerprint, card, and platform integration.
Custom design also helps brands stand out. Ask the manufacturer whether it can customize color, finish, logo, packaging, manual language, app UI, and lock structure. If you need a private model, ask about tooling cost, ownership, lead time, and protection rules. Practical Buyer Checklist Before Choosing Smart Lock Manufacturers
Before making a final decision, use a simple checklist. It helps your team compare suppliers in the same way. This is useful when engineering, purchasing, sales, and management all join the decision. It also helps avoid choosing a factory only because of a low unit price.
- Confirm OEM/ODM scope: Check whether the factory can support design, engineering, tooling, production, packaging, and after-sales service.
- Check certificates: Review FCC, CE, ISO9001, ISO14001, QC080000, IECQ, and product-specific certificate needs.
- Audit quality control: Ask for testing steps, inspection records, batch traceability, and defect data.
- Review capacity: Compare factory area, production lines, daily output, warehouse space, and peak-season planning.
- Test real samples: Check unlocking speed, app connection, battery behavior, emergency power, installation, and user experience.
- Study service response: Confirm who answers technical questions and how fast they respond after shipment.
You may also review the UL 294 access control system testing information if your project involves access control system units. Not every residential smart lock needs the same standard. Still, it is useful to understand how professional access control products are tested for reliability and function.
